发布网友 发布时间:2022-04-26 17:16
共4个回答
热心网友 时间:2023-10-16 15:22
(i-1)%k≠0时,该结点有右兄弟,其右兄弟的编号为i+1。
解释:假设i减去根节点的“1”,就是剩下的所有结点,如果(1-1)正好是k的倍数,说明i结点的位置就是在i的所有兄弟结点的最右端(建议你画一个图更方便理解)。如果它有右结点。
例如:
T中有三种点总共n个,设这三种点的个数:
k度点 2 个
1度叶结点e叶个
其余点 v' 个,他们度数为[2,k-1)范围内
可列以下公式:
e叶+2+v'=n
e叶+2k+pv'=2n-2(总度数为2n-2)
2≤p<k
解上述方程组,得e叶≥2k-2。
扩展资料:
满二叉树的任意节点,要么度为0,要么度为2.换个说法即要么为叶子结点,要么同时具有左右孩子。霍夫曼树是符合这种定义的,满足国际上定义的满二叉树,但是不满足国内的定义。
一种基于满二叉树的原地快速排序算法。 与经典快速排序算法相比, 新算法每趟划分采用动态枢轴而不是静态枢轴, 同时新算法利用满二叉树的特点计算下一趟划分的枢轴位置和元素范围, 避免使用递归或开辟内存堆栈。
参考资料来源:百度百科-满二叉树
热心网友 时间:2023-10-16 15:23
(i-1)%k≠0时,该结点有右兄弟,其右兄弟的编号为i+1。 解释:假设i减去根节点的“1”,就是剩下的所有结点,如果(1-1)正好是k的倍数,说明i结点的位置就是在i的所有兄弟结点的最右端(建议你画一个图更方便理解)。如果它有右结点热心网友 时间:2023-10-16 15:23
这个问题呢是这样的,首先大家要明白最少的概念,对于一颗二叉树来讲如果说左子树的深度为2,又子树的深度为1那么,这个时候就是 T就为正则二叉树,高度为2 ,最少就为5个节点,然后,这个地方大家可再去忘更深处构造,可以发现这个题的二叉树均满足,对于任意的一个节点来说,他都始终和一个叶子节点相连,所以说 ,对于从根节点往下的每一层来说,都只有K个节点,因此有K*(h-1)个节点,所以说,再加上最一开始的那个,就应该会有 K*(h-1)+1个节点。对于最多来说,就是每一个节点都尽可能的增加叶子节点 所以说,每层都会有 K^(h-1)个节点 ,等比累加求和,可得热心网友 时间:2023-10-16 15:24
(h-1)k+1